About

Irwin Naturals, Inc. engages in the development and distribution of vitamins and other health supplements in the United States, Canada, and internationally. The company offers CBD oils, gummies, soft gels, CBD creams, balms and roll-ons, vitamins and supplements, topicals, and other products. It also operates mental health clinics. Irwin Naturals, Inc. (IWINQ)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of September 2023: $13.88 Million US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Irwin Naturals, Inc. (IWINQ) has net assets worth $13.88 Million USD as of September 2023.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($70.86 Million) and total liabilities ($56.97 Million).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.
